With the leadership of former head of the Blondie fan club in Los Angeles, The Gun Club was a pioneer when it comes to mixing punk with americana. Imagine The White Stripes in the 80s and even better (and this is not an insult to the band of Jack and Meg White, which is great too). The leader of this band, Jeffrey Lee Pierce, might be the best and most distinctive guitarrist in the whole genre (with Johnny Thunders, at least). You may notice that I'm not mentioning other members of the group, but that's because there were a lot. About their discography, they released seven studio records (plus one EP: "Death Party"), but I only listened to the first four so far. Even while it is said that their best album is their debut ("Fire of Love"), my favourite is their second effort: "Miami". But all of which I listened to so far is great, so there's no loss in listening to their output beyond those two. Here's a song from them.
